A reputable nursery organization in London is seeking a Room Leader to guide a team in delivering exceptional care and education for children aged 3 months to 5 years. The ideal candidate will possess a Level 3 Early Years qualification and relevant experience.

Responsibilities include:

  • Mentoring staff
  • Ensuring child welfare and safety
  • Building strong partnerships with parents

The role offers a competitive salary starting from £31,512, plus substantial benefits, under a supportive organizational culture.

How to prepare for a job interview at Bright Horizons Early Education & Preschool

Know Your Early Years Stuff

Make sure you brush up on your knowledge of early years education and child development. Be ready to discuss your Level 3 qualification and how it applies to the role. Think about specific examples from your experience that showcase your understanding of child welfare and safety.

Showcase Your Leadership Skills

As a Room Leader, you'll be guiding a team, so it's crucial to demonstrate your leadership abilities. Prepare to share instances where you've successfully mentored staff or led a team in a nursery setting. Highlight how you inspire others and create a positive environment for both children and colleagues.

Build Connections with Parents

Part of your role will involve building strong partnerships with parents. Think about how you've engaged with parents in the past and be ready to discuss strategies for effective communication. Show that you understand the importance of involving parents in their child's learning journey.
